Output 34066aa89ca8d3df41e16edb71b5d1f23c618bad7f86df3af22e26f5e2efc7f8:0

value
1238
script pubkey
OP_0 OP_PUSHBYTES_20 ba404136ddf7b70832497244703f04e055c756ec
address
bc1qhfqyzdka77mssvjfwfz8q0cyup2uw4hvrfqa52
transaction
34066aa89ca8d3df41e16edb71b5d1f23c618bad7f86df3af22e26f5e2efc7f8
spent
true